CRM stands for Customer Relationship Management. A CRM software is a tool which allows organizations and businesses to manage its customers in an efficient manner.
On its own, a CRM software is not enough. To use CRM software more effectively, a company has to establish a system of business processes and procedures to supplement the CRM business tool. The business processes and procedures implemented should be aligned with the CRM software being used. Otherwise, the use of CRM becomes chaotic and complex and the software will not be well-received by the employees of the company.
When this initial obstacle has been overcome, the power of using a CRM software takes off. Optimal use of a CRM software will result to better management of customer interactions at all points of contact: from lead capture and generation, lead incubation and finally lead conversion.
Managing the entire customer related functions with the use of CRM software is the key to business success. Customers become more satisfied, gratified and delighted. With the efficiencies introduced by a CRM software, it will reduce operating costs and help all customer-facing personnel of the company make better and timely decisions. More importantly, a successful CRM software implementation will result to more happy customers which will translate to more profits for the company.
